May 2025 - Apr 2026Sutton Passeys Crescent area has the 15th lowest crime rate of 39 local areas in Lenton & Wollaton East , and the 137th lowest crime rate of 934 local areas in Nottingham .
This postcode forms a relatively safe pocket compared with the surrounding streets. Neighbouring areas record much higher crime levels, even though this postcode itself remains comparatively low-crime.
The overall crime rate in the area around Sutton Passeys Crescent (NG8 1EA) in the last 12 months was 33.1 per 1,000 residents and was 69.8% lower than the Lenton & Wollaton East average (109.4 per 1,000 residents). In the last 12 months, this area’s most reported crimes were Violence and sexual offences with 4 offences recorded. The least common crime was Anti-social behaviour with 1 case , unchanged from 2025. The fastest-growing crime category was Vehicle crime ( 100.0% YoY). Other major crime categories were broadly unchanged compared to 2025.
Violent crimes totalled 4 (≈ 16.5 per 1,000 residents). Year-over-year these were rising ( 100.0% ). Over the last decade, overall crime has falling ( -52.8% comparing early vs recent averages) .
In the area around Sutton Passeys Crescent (NG8 1EA), the main crime hotspot is near Supermarket. Police recorded 167 crimes here, including 44 violent or public-order offences. All these locations are within roughly 0.3 miles.
